Interim head coach for Hearts of Oak, Edward Nii Odoom has named a strong starting eleven to go up against Great Olympics in the Mantse Derby this evening.

The capital-based club will lock horns this evening in a Match Week 14 fixture of the ongoing 2019/2020 Ghana Premier League season. Not only will they be fighting for 3 points, but both clubs also want to win to have the bragging right for who is the real landlord of Accra.

Ahead of kick-off which is at 19:00GMT at the Accra Sports Stadium, interim head coach of Hearts of Oak, Edward Nii Odoom has named a strong first eleven to face Olympics.

Captain Fatawu Mohammed is dropped to the bench while midfielder Emmanuel Nettey comes in as well as attackers Michelle Sarpong and Afriyie Barnie.
